Research evaluates Nuance Audio glasses in lab, real world

EssilorLuxottica has announced new clinical findings from two studies, including one in Australia, evaluating the performance of Nuance Audio glasses, the global optical group’s all-in-one open-ear hearing solution built into smart eyewear and intended for adults with mild to moderate hearing loss.

In a media release, it said the results were presented for the first time in Europe during the 69th EUHA Congress (European Union of Hearing Aid Acousticians) in Hanover, Germany, as part of the official academic program.

Dr Tami Harel, chief of audiology of Nuance Audio, EssilorLuxottica, presented the session on “Clinical Efficacy of Open-Ear Hearing Aid Glasses”, sharing outcomes from studies conducted at Western University (Canada) and the National Acoustic Laboratories (NAL, Australia).

The studies evaluated both controlled laboratory performance and real-world listening experiences, demonstrating consistent benefits for users in everyday communication.

The release said the Western study in Canada evaluated Nuance Audio glasses in controlled yet realistic noise conditions, designed to simulate daily listening environments.

Results demonstrated:

  • Up to 29% improvement in speech understanding in challenging acoustic conditions.
  • Significant reduction in listening effort, as measured through standardised rating scales.
  • These outcomes highlight the potential of Nuance Audio glasses to support improved communication performance in noisy listening environments.

The Australian NAL study assessed both laboratory performance and short supervised real-world use. Reported outcomes included:

  • 3.48 dB improvement in signal-to-noise ratio (SNR), a clinically meaningful gain in speech-in-noise performance.
  • 70% of participants reported improved communication ability after only three hours of real-world use.
  • Participants’ top communication goals were met in 84–95% of cases.
  • Participants preferred using the glasses more as the acoustic environment became more challenging.

EssilorLuxottica said that, together, the findings showed a coherent trajectory, from measurable acoustic improvements in controlled laboratory conditions, to meaningful real-world communication benefits, and ultimately to a clear user preference for Nuance Audio glasses in more challenging listening environments.

“One insight stands out across both studies: users prefer to wear Nuance Audio glasses in the real, noisy conversations that matter most to them,” said Dr Harel.

“These results mark an important achievement in terms of the post-market clinical validation of the product for early-stage hearing support.

“These new clinical findings represent an important milestone for EssilorLuxottica,” said Stefano Genco, global head of Nuance Audio, EssilorLuxottica.

“Results from the two studies validate our vision of integrating advanced open-ear hearing technology into smart eyewear, addressed to an estimated 1.25 billion worldwide affected by mild to moderate hearing loss.”
